Push Notification
A push notification is a message sent directly to a user's mobile device or web browser, even when they're not actively using your app or website. It's one of the most immediate communication channels available.
Types of Push Notifications
- Mobile App Push: Sent through iOS/Android to app users
- Web Push: Sent through the browser to website visitors who opted in
Best Practices
- Keep messages short and actionable (under 50 characters for titles)
- Use sparingly — over-sending leads to opt-outs
- Time notifications based on user activity patterns
- Personalize content based on user behavior
- Include a clear call-to-action
